Precision Engineering for Power Generation Machining

Power plants run on components that cannot fail. Rockwell Precision’s Houston facility delivers industrial machining for power generation applications that demand tight tolerances and consistent repeatability. Our horizontal and vertical CNC mills, gun drilling systems, and multi-axis turning centers are built to handle the complexity of turbine housings, valve bodies, rotating assemblies, compressor parts, and heat exchanger components. From prototype to full production, Rockwell Precision gives power producers the accuracy their operations depend on.

Rockwell’s shop runs horizontal and vertical CNC mills, multi-axis lathes, and gun drilling systems sized for large, intricate parts. Every machine is calibrated for consistent output, keeping both prototype and full production runs on schedule and within tolerance.

Rockwell Precision machines stainless steel, Inconel, titanium, and other high-strength alloys that power generation environments demand. Our knowledge of these materials allows us to hold tight tolerances while protecting tool life and surface integrity in high-heat, high-pressure conditions. Machining for power plants requires material expertise that goes beyond standard alloys, and Rockwell Precision is equipped to meet that standard.

Our ISO 9001:2015 certification reflects a disciplined approach to quality and process traceability. Every power generation machining project moves through strict documentation and inspection at each stage, ensuring full compliance with client and regulatory requirements.

Rockwell Precision’s CAD-CAM programming team uses detailed 3D simulations and optimized toolpaths to reduce setup time and eliminate machining errors before the first cut. Our technology supports accurate power plant component machining from the earliest stage of production, ensuring finished parts are ready for plant installation without rework or delay.

Rapid Reverse Engineering

When E3 approached Rockwell Precision to reverse engineer a potential product, our team scanned the part and produced detailed prints in just one week. That quick turnaround helped E3 become a market powerhouse, now controlling more than 70% of its segment.

Product Innovation and Redesign

Rockwell Precision worked with E3’s engineers to upgrade their original five-piece valve design into a two-piece solution. The improved design offered superior durability, easier maintenance, and better performance, giving E3 a measurable advantage in the energy market.
